鄧欣偉
[摘 要]污水排放監控系統主要是針對政府和企業對污水排放總量進行實時監控的需求而設計的。這套污水排放總量實時監測系統,本系統通過保障收集來的數據,包括運行日期,運行時間,水位,流速,瞬時流量,累積流量等,來實現對污水的實時監控。此軟件有強大的數據顯示,存儲及查詢功能。對污水的排放量進行了實時監測并進行處理。本系統主要功能包括:污水流量顯示及處理,實時數據顯示及處理,系統相關測試,報警記錄及處理,歷史數據處理,系統設置等。
[關鍵詞]污水監控 實時數據 數據處理
隨著時代的發展和科學技術的進步,人們對信息交換和處理的要求也越來越高了。計算機的這一應用到現在已經有了很好的普及,并且已經收到了良好的效果.而使用的前臺開發工具又以Borland公司開發的Delphi應用最為廣泛。
這套環保數據監測處理子系統是針對工業污水排放的監測系統而發的。包括實時數據的寫入,實時數據的面板,曲線,表格顯示,查詢歷史數據等功能的管理。
一、數據需求分析
綜合的信息管理系統的優點之一就是系統的各部分之間可以共享數據,從而達到減少工作量和保持數據一致的目的。
1.流量計編號
流量計編號是污水排放信息管理必不可少的數據。
2.污水排放信息的維護
污水排放信息的維護,即當有新的數據寫入時,首先應把該數據加入污水排放實時數據表中,按指定的格式排列好,這樣就方便了查詢。污水排放信息是按照流量計編號、監測時間、監測日期、水位、流速、瞬時流量、累計流量這些方面排放的,不僅省時又省力,方便了用戶的查詢。主要目的是將26個工廠的流量計的數據實時采集到上位機的數據中,并且要實時測試超標數據,以便監控。所以將數據庫建立成實時數據表、日數據表、月數據表、年數據表、參數范圍數據表、超標數據表、撥號號碼數據表、工廠代碼數據表、查詢表。
二、模塊組成和基本流程
1.首先數據存儲要求準確、詳盡。即信息管理必須準確表示每一個基本屬性,如污水的流量計編號、監測時間、監測日期、水位、流速、瞬時流量、累計流量等。最后,污水排放信息的存儲必須方便查詢,也就是說在考慮到各種特殊情況時,一定要兼顧存儲上一般與特殊的統一,否則,對污水排放信息的查詢將變得極其復雜、效率極低,甚至將使查詢變成實際上的不可行。
2.實現對污水排放信息的各種查詢
對污水排放信息的查詢是信息管理中使用最頻繁的功能,主要要求是符合用戶的需求。對污水排放信息的查詢操作主要有:按流量計編號、水位、流速、瞬時流量、累計流量,時間進行查詢。
3.必要信息的輸出
雖然污水信息的自動化管理可以使許多操作由計算機實現從而減少了許多中間報表,有一些資料必須按一定的格式輸出
4.排放指標設置設計
上面程序中調用了Config 單元,Config單元設計界面如下圖4.5所示。本單元主要是對Config表進行運行期間設置,根據需求分析,每年各測點的排放標準是不同的,故而允許操作人員動態修改。在這里可以修改的數據為最高水位、最低水位、最大流速、最小流速、最大瞬時流量、最小瞬時流量、最大累計流量、最小累計流量,可以根據具體的需要在這里進行具體的數據修改。
5.實時數據設計
由于要求幾種顯示方式達到同步,所以要求他們用的數據源要相同,都是DataMD.Datasource。
三、系統測試
在編制調試階段完成后,系統并沒有完成,而是轉入了系統的測試階段,這個階段在開發軟件時占相當大的比重。系統測試的主要任務就是控制系統的運行,并以多種角度觀察程序運行時的狀態。
測試采用的是先單元后系統的測試方法,單元測試指的是各模塊的測試。完成全部界面設計和代碼編寫工作后,就可以運行工業污水排放監測系統了,運行時應該首先看到的是flash啟動畫面,然后進入系統主界面,開始進行對測點測試,在測試之前,系統需要對每一個測點進行撥號測試,如果撥號測試成功,則在測點處以小圖標形式提示,表示此測點工作正常,可以進行數據采樣。主要點:
對測點測試完成后將進行撥號,系統開始對26個測點進行數據收集。在工業污水排放監測系統的實時數據中,可以實現對數據信息的面板顯示、表格顯示、曲線顯示和報表顯示。在系統的主界面中,單擊“歷史數據”按鈕,就可以進行歷史數據的查詢,在歷史數據的查詢中,可以改變流量計編號來查詢各個測點,也可以按你想查詢的日期進行查詢,在歷史數據的查詢界面中可以實現曲線顯示和報表對數據進行查詢。
在對各個模塊測試后應對集成各個模塊的系統進行整體測試,從系統的開始到系統的結束,自始至終進行一遍,測試模塊之間的調用是否正常,若發現錯誤,應仔細分析模塊之間的調用關系找出可能存在的錯誤,更正后,在調用進行測試,周而復始,直到達到理想為止。
參考文獻:
[1]李文池,王佳祥.Delphi程序設計基礎.2006年8月第一版.中國水利水電出版社,2006:69~89
[2]陳秋勁.Delphi數據庫編程與應用.2007年1月第一版.機械工業出版社,2007: 321~350
[3]李杰,孫君.數據庫原理與應用簡明教程.2007年5月第一版.清華大學出版社,2007:237~301